Celebrating the 40th anniversary of one of the UK's most successful bands. This intimate portrait of Madness was filmed in 2019 as the band perform at Camden's Electric Ballroom in November 2019 and The Roundhouse in December 2019.
Original Broadcast: 19/09/2020 [Sky Arts HD]
Aspect Ratio: 4:3 (but was filmed & broadcast as 16:9 so apologies but this was taken from my old DVD Recorder)
